  • One of the primary functions of food additives is to preserve food and extend its shelf life. Preservatives like sodium benzoate and potassium sorbate prevent the growth of harmful microorganisms, thereby reducing the risk of foodborne illnesses. By inhibiting the spoilage of perishable items, such as dairy products and meat, these additives ensure that consumers receive safe and high-quality food. In addition to microbial growth, antioxidants such as ascorbic acid and tocopherols help prevent oxidation, which can lead to rancidity in fats and oils. This function is particularly critical in maintaining the freshness of processed foods and snacks, allowing them to remain appealing for longer periods.

  • 3. Enzymes Enzyme additives are used to facilitate the fermentation process and improve dough handling. Amylase, for example, breaks down starches into sugars that yeast can ferment more efficiently, helping the bread rise better and enhancing its flavor. Diastatic malt, another enzymatic additive, contributes to the browning of the crust and can improve the bread's sweetness. These natural additives are generally considered beneficial, as they help maintain quality and improve nutritional content.


  • Isopropyl alcohol, also known as isopropanol or 2-propanol, is a colorless, flammable chemical compound with a strong odor. With the molecular formula C3H8O, it is one of the simplest forms of alcohol and plays a crucial role in numerous applications across various industries. From medical disinfectants to household cleaners, isopropyl alcohol's versatile nature makes it an essential compound in our daily lives.

  • In commercial settings, the decision on the size of access panels often involves regulatory considerations. Building codes dictate specific standards for access panels, especially in areas where safety and compliance are paramount. For instance, panels in healthcare facilities may need to be large enough to facilitate the maintenance of large-scale equipment or ductwork. Likewise, in commercial kitchens, the access panels should be adequately sized to permit efficient cleaning and maintenance of grease ducts.

  • Apart from their acoustic properties, mineral fiber ceiling tiles also offer enhanced fire resistance. The mineral wool composition makes them inherently non-combustible, adding an extra layer of safety to the ceiling system. In case of a fire, mineral fiber ceiling tiles can help delay the spread of flames and contribute to the overall fire safety measures of a building.

  • In addition to sound absorption, ceiling mineral fiber offers thermal insulation properties. The material helps regulate indoor temperatures by preventing heat loss in winter and keeping spaces cooler in summer. This thermal efficiency contributes to energy savings, as less heating and cooling is required to maintain comfortable temperatures. For homeowners and businesses looking to reduce their energy bills and carbon footprint, mineral fiber ceilings present a practical solution.

  • A suspended ceiling tile grid is a framework system that supports tiles, panels, or other acoustic materials. This grid is hung from the overhead structural ceiling using metal suspension wires or hangers, allowing the tiles to be installed at a lower height. The space between the suspended ceiling and the original ceiling can be utilized for various purposes, including hiding wiring, ductwork, and other mechanical components, thereby creating a neat and organized appearance.

  • A drop ceiling, also known as a suspended ceiling, is a secondary ceiling hung below the main structural ceiling. It is commonly used in commercial buildings, offices, schools, and even residential spaces to conceal unsightly pipes, wires, and other mechanical elements while providing easy access for maintenance. The cross tee, a rectangular or T-shaped metal component, is an essential part of the grid system that supports the ceiling tiles.
